Geordie has launched Cost Intelligence, a product that links AI spending to the agents and workflows behind it.

The move extends Geordie's work in agent oversight into financial monitoring as businesses seek clearer explanations for rising AI bills.

AI spending is often tracked through model usage, token volumes and invoices, but those measures do not show which tasks or decisions drove the costs. Cost Intelligence is designed to help AI operations teams trace spending back to individual agents, the activities they carried out and the workflows they supported.

The issue is becoming more acute as AI tools spread across organisations and costs vary from one agent run to another. In one case cited by Geordie, a retailer lost USD $1 million a month through model-routing waste when tasks were sent to more expensive models than necessary. In another, a bank used 50% of its monthly AI budget in a single day after an agent became stuck in a tool loop.

Broader risk

Geordie has so far focused on security and governance around AI agents. Its system sits close to the agent itself, allowing it to observe behaviour in detail and apply that same view to spending, token use and model selection.

That means teams investigating a jump in costs can identify which agent acted, what work it performed and who was responsible. This gives finance, operations and security teams a shared record of how AI systems are behaving inside the business.

Detailed view

The product aggregates spending across connected platforms and attributes it to the work that generated it. Users can move from an organisation-wide total to narrower views by platform, team, user, model, agent or workflow.

It also tracks cache efficiency at the level of the individual agent, which can show where poor caching is increasing costs. Another feature maps spending and usage volume by agent to distinguish between agents that are expensive because they are busy and useful, and agents that are generating waste.

The system can also flag cost anomalies such as infinite loops, oversized model selection and sessions that consume large volumes of tokens without producing useful output.

These controls matter because AI agent risk is widening beyond cybersecurity. As organisations allow agents to handle more tasks with less human intervention, oversight is shifting toward operational and financial exposure as well as technical safety.

Cost Intelligence is generally available, giving customers a way to examine AI spending across cloud, code and endpoint environments rather than only where activity passes through a single gateway or model router.
